Authorities in Jo Daviess County have released details surrounding the death of a Rochester High School student who passed away Friday night.
According to the Jo Daviess County Sheriff’s Office, 911 dispatchers received a call around 9:08 p.m. on February 13, 2026, reporting a possible drowning at Chestnut Mountain Resort in Galena.
The report states that the student, later identified by the Jo Daviess County Coroner’s Office as Jack Zucco, had been swimming in a pool when he appeared to lose consciousness. Another juvenile at the scene pulled him from the water before emergency responders arrived.
EMS personnel began life-saving measures while awaiting the arrival of an air ambulance. Despite their efforts, Zucco was pronounced deceased at the scene.
Authorities emphasized that the incident is being thoroughly investigated. No additional details regarding the circumstances have been released at this time.
The sheriff’s office and coroner’s office continue to work to provide answers for Zucco’s family and the community. Officials encourage anyone with relevant information about the incident to contact the Jo Daviess County Sheriff’s Office.
